a rush of的基本解释
读音: 美: 英:
一股:指突然涌现的强烈感觉或情绪。
例句
He had a rush of blood to the head and punched the man.他一时冲动,挥拳打了那个男人。《牛津词典》a rush of air on my face woke me.脸上的一股急促的气流惊醒了我。《柯林斯英汉双解大词典》
a rush of pure affection swept over him.一股强烈的真爱掠过了他的心田。《柯林斯英汉双解大词典》
短语
a rush of panic and 惊慌的奔跑a rush of sympathy 突涌的同情
a rush of work 一阵匆忙的工作
